Job Summary

The Hotel Storekeeper is responsible for managing and maintaining the general stores, including consumables, chemicals, equipment, and uniforms at one or more Carnival Corporation owned and operated global destination. This role ensures that all inventory items are properly received, stored, tracked, and distributed efficiently to meet operational requirements. The Storekeeper monitors inventory levels, coordinates with different departments to fulfill stock needs, and supports the overall management of resources. Responsibilities include inspecting deliveries for accuracy and quality, maintaining records, organizing storage areas, and ensuring compliance with safety and handling standards. The role requires attention to detail, strong organizational skills, and the ability to work collaboratively to maintain seamless store operations.
